Sofern nicht anders angegeben, beziehen sich die Direktiven sowohl auf Embedded SQL- als auch auf C++-API-Anwendungen.
Sie können Compilerdirektiven wie folgt angeben:
In Ihrer Compiler-Befehlszeile. Eine Direktive wird gewöhnlich mit der Option /D angegeben. Um z.B. eine UltraLite-Anwendung mit Benutzerauthentifizierung zu kompilieren, sieht ein Makefile für den Microsoft Visual C++-Compiler möglicherweise wie folgt aus:
CompileOptions=/c /DPRWIN32 /Od /Zi /DWIN32 /DUL_USE_DLL IncludeFolders= \ /I"$(VCDIR)\include" \ /I"$(SQLANY11)\SDK\Include" sample.obj: sample.cpp cl $(CompileOptions) $(IncludeFolders) sample.cpp |
Dabei gilt: VCDIR ist das Visual C++-Verzeichnis und SQLANY11 ist das SQL Anywhere-Installationsverzeichnis.
Im Fenster der Compiler-Einstellungen auf der Benutzeroberfläche.
Im Quellcode. Direktiven werden mit der Anweisung #define
angegeben.
UL_AS_SYNCHRONIZE-Makro
UL_SYNC_ALL-Makro
UL_SYNC_ALL_PUBS-Makro
UL_TEXT-Makro
UL_USE_DLL-Makro
UNDER_CE-Makro
UNDER_PALM_OS-Makro
Kommentieren Sie diese Seite in DocCommentXchange. Senden Sie uns Feedback über diese Seite via E-Mail. |
Copyright © 2009, iAnywhere Solutions, Inc. - SQL Anywhere 11.0.1 |